Transaction 37ef0c7c41941db53f734fa24feaecfd0871a69e44dcf797120e60e8c93f6145

2 Input
1 Outputs
  • 37ef0c7c41941db53f734fa24feaecfd0871a69e44dcf797120e60e8c93f6145:0
  • value  22093500
    address  bc1q8yrfjrfxftj8sew2ch58dtq5vdfxgmlggrrdrx